Determine the quotient of 3/5 and 2/3


Sagot :

Answer:

The result is [tex]\frac{9}{10}[/tex]

Step-by-step explanation:

Below are the steps to divide fractions:

  1. The 1st fraction remains untouched.
  2. The division sign turns into a multiplication sign.
  3. Flip the 2nd fraction over (finding its reciprocal)
  4. Multiply the numerators (top numbers) together
  5. Multiply the denominators (bottom numbers) together.
  6. Simplify the resulting fraction by dividing both numerator and denominator by the same number.

Let's follow the above steps:

Steps 1, 2 and 3 can be done together.

[tex]\frac{3}{5}:\frac{2}{3} = \frac{3}{5}.\frac{3}{2}[/tex]

As you can see, we leave 1st fraction alone, change division sign (:) by multiplication sign (.), and flip 2nd fraction over.

Now, we can do steps 4 and 5...

[tex]\frac{3}{5}:\frac{2}{3} = \frac{3}{5}.\frac{3}{2} = \frac{3.3}{5.2} = \frac{9}{10}[/tex]

Finally, step 6, we cannot simplify the resulting fraction since both numerator and denominator have no common factors.

9 = 3 . 3

10 = 2 . 5
